Output 751e284452e4d1808523637bd857ca80e0bd1d186316e8c605d125bc0311c247:0

value
3120017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45a1781af98e5f124aabe3f4598b5c420317fd62 OP_EQUALVERIFY OP_CHECKSIG
address
17MB4JzxFRbJxhRQ63WCNB5NcUFzzKXCfV
transaction
751e284452e4d1808523637bd857ca80e0bd1d186316e8c605d125bc0311c247
spent
true